Tracking Business Performance During Growth in Louisiana
Effective performance tracking is essential for businesses scaling operations in Louisiana. Monitoring key metrics helps identify opportunities, manage resources, and maintain compliance as your business expands.
Key Operational Metrics to Monitor
- Revenue and Sales Growth: Track monthly and quarterly sales to evaluate market demand and adjust strategies.
- Cash Flow Management: Monitor inflows and outflows closely to ensure liquidity, especially when investing in new hires or equipment.
- Profit Margins: Analyze gross and net margins to identify cost-saving opportunities and pricing effectiveness.
- Customer Acquisition and Retention: Measure customer growth rates and repeat business to assess marketing and service quality.
- Employee Productivity: Use payroll and output data to evaluate workforce efficiency during expansion phases.
Operational Tools and Practices
- Implement Automated Reporting: Use accounting and business intelligence software to generate real-time dashboards for financial and operational data.
- Maintain Accurate Bookkeeping: Ensure all transactions and expenses are recorded promptly to support tax reporting and cash flow analysis.
- Regular Compliance Checks: Stay updated on Louisiana-specific licensing, tax, and employment regulations to avoid penalties during growth.
- Set Clear KPIs: Establish measurable goals aligned with your growth strategy, such as sales targets or customer satisfaction scores.
- Employee Classification and Payroll: Monitor classifications carefully to comply with Louisiana labor laws and optimize payroll management.
Reporting and Review Frequency
As of 2026, best practices recommend monthly reviews of financial and operational reports during scaling. Quarterly in-depth performance assessments can help adjust strategies and resource allocation effectively.
